Who needs Medium Term Accommodation?

Medium Term Accommodation (MTA) is designed for NDIS participants who are in a transitional phase and need a temporary, supported place to live while waiting for their confirmed long-term housing arrangements to become available.

Common Situations Requiring MTA

Waiting for a Confirmed Long-Term Home: The person has secured a permanent housing solution (like a Specialist Disability Accommodation (SDA) apartment, a Supported Independent Living (SIL) vacancy, or a private rental) but cannot move in yet.

Awaiting Disability Supports: The delay in moving is specifically because their disability supports aren’t ready, such as: Waiting for home modifications (renovations) to be completed in their new or existing home.

Waiting for Assistive Technology (AT) (like a ceiling hoist or complex equipment) to be delivered and installed.

Transitioning from a Facility: The person needs to move out of an unsuitable environment but their permanent housing is not ready.

This includes:

  • Discharge from a hospital or rehabilitation facility.
  • Moving from a residential aged care facility (often applicable to
    younger people).
  • Exiting a custodial setting (justice system).
  • Breakdown of Current Living Arrangement: They can no longer remain in
    their current, unstable accommodation (e.g., a sudden breakdown of
    informal family/carer supports).

Medium Term NDIS Funding

Your Temporary Housing Pathway

The MTA budget is provided as a daily rate under your Core Supports budget (Assistance with Daily Life).
This covers the cost of the Accommodation.
The rental fee for the temporary accessible property (like a house, apartment, or shared living setting) provided by the MTA provider.
